Spectrogram-based Music Retrieval

As the wide spread of computers and the rapid development of Internet,digital music reaches the far corner of the world.This brings about the issue of how to find a song efficiently and effectively.Tag-based music retrieval is currently the only popular approach to access music.As a customer,you need to figure out the relevant tag information,while as a service provider, much labor is involved to manage the database.Meanwhile,troubles as follows usually haunt us:a clip of melody occurs to us but brings no identity information along with it.Therefore, the problems give birth to the content-based music retrieval(CBMR),which focuses on music features that can express its content,and thereby guarantees the retrieval accuracy.With an intensive research on spectrogram,we try depicting the music content implicitly and building a fuzzy "image" for each song based on it.A simple feature matrix is proposed to represent music texture which can amortize the impact of noise disturbance.Moreover,the feature matrix stores relative data instead of absolute data to enhance its robustness.We also propose a new similarity algorithm based on the music theory and the sound nature.It deduces the similarity degree of two features by dot-dividing them,setting weights and a normal interval for the elements and computing the rate of abnormal elements.A positioning algorithm of the anchor points will accelerate the speed of matching.MARBOS is built on the above theory and research.It takes query-by-example as input, portrays the music content in spectrogram feature matrix and deploys matrix similarity algorithm to match queries against candidates in the database.A group of experiments conducted to evaluate several characteristics indicates a better performance of MARBOS than one designed with the main stream idea.
